> If CallInterceptor.handleDefault(...) is called with a RemoteTxInvocationContext, and if command invocation throws an exception, the catch clause ends up hiding this with an IllegalStateException.
> The culprit is RemoteTxInvocationContext.isValidRunningTx(), which internally calls RemoteTxInvocationContext.getRunningTransaction(), which always throws an ISE.
> If this method would instead return null, RemoteTxInvocationContext.isValidRunningTx() will return false, and all is well, and the genuine exception can propagate properly.
